English: A soldier from 101st Light Anti-Aircraft Regiment prepares for D-Day by reading his French handbook at a camp near Portsmouth, 29 May 1944. A soldier from 101st Light Anti-Aircraft Regiment (12th King's Regiment (Liverpool)) 3rd Division, prepares for D Day by reading at his French handbook at Camp A2 at Emsworth, near Portsmouth, Hampshire, 29 May 1944. |
